  • Schedule 13G & 13D forms are used to report a party's ownership of stock which exceeds 5% of a company's total stock issue.
  • Schedule 13G is a shorter version of Schedule 13D with fewer reporting requirements.

*Newtyn Management is the investment manager to NP and NTE. As of May 19, 2023, NP held 409,918 shares of Preferred Stock and NTE held 255,692 shares of Preferred Stock. Newtyn Management, as the investment manager to NP and NTE, may be deemed to beneficially own these securities. Accordingly, as of May 19, 2023, Newtyn Management may be deemed to beneficially own the 665,610 shares of Preferred Stock held in the aggregate by NP and NTE.

 

The foregoing beneficial ownership percentage is based upon 10,319,782 shares of Preferred Stock issued and outstanding as of May 19, 2023, based on information disclosed by the Company on its website.
